Is Seattle the best location for your upcoming wedding? Should you consider hosting your special occasion in a brewery? Here are some things to think about:
Pros
Brewery weddings are unique and atmospheric because the locations have rustic and/or industrial elements. They provide a memorable experience for your guests.
Many brewery spaces tend to be more cost-effective than traditional wedding venues, especially if you're hosting a smaller event.
Seattle brewery spaces provide a casual, no-fuss vibe for your wedding, which is refreshing.
Cons
You might experience decor restrictions in the brewery venue of your choice, which could be a problem if you want to personalize the location.
Some brewery spaces have noise restrictions, so you might have to reconsider booking that loud metal band!
Seattle traffic can cause delays and challenges for your wedding guests.

Before you start planning a brewery wedding in Seattle, you should consider some important tips, especially because brewery venues vary from each other quite a bit in terms of what they offer.
Choose a Venue with Proper Seating – Unless the brewery space contains tables and chairs, you might only have picnic tables and benches at your disposal. Since this might not be ideal for your specific wedding, think about what items you should supply yourself to keep your guests as comfortable as possible.
Think About How Much Space You Need – Choose a wedding venue from Giggster's 0 location listings that has enough space for a ceremony and/or reception, dinner, dancing, and other wedding activities. Take your guest capacity into account when finding the best venue.
Take Time to Plan the Acoustics – One of the things you might find lacking in a beer garden or other brewery venue is acoustics. These venues tend to echo, so you'll have to make provision for excellent sound for your wedding speeches and music, such as by adjusting mic levels and using directional speakers.
Add Details to the Decor – While brewery spaces usually have rustic decor, you should still add some personality to the decor to elevate it if you want a chic wedding, such as with balloons, gold-trimmed items, and photo booths for guests to enjoy. A few sparkly details will elevate the venue's glam factor.
If you're planning a wedding on a budget, you should consider some important ways to cut down your expenses. Your dream wedding doesn't have to put you into debt!
Choose a venue with both an indoor and outdoor space.
You should consider selecting an indoor and outdoor venue so you can host all your wedding activities, such as the ceremony and reception, in the same place. This will reduce your expenses for things like transport, setting up the different venues, and so on.
Set a bar tab for guests.
A bar tap with a cap is important if you're hosting a wedding in a brewery because your guests will be encouraged to try all the delicious beers or other beverages that are available. You could also set a drink token that specifies every guest has access to a maximum of two drinks before they have to switch to a cash bar.
Hire vendors skilled at brewery weddings.
It can save you some money when planning your wedding by working with a vendor who specializes in rustic or brewery weddings. You'll streamline your planning because they'll know how to meet your vision. Plus, vendors can help you cut costs by directing you to more affordable resources.
